-- Disclaimer -- The following includes some conjecture. Zephyris might correct me on any of the below --

Full LV4 compatibility is not a goal for the Heavy Equipment set. It's not that we think there's anything wrong with LV4, just that it gets very complex to be compatible with multiple sets.

The Heavy Equipment set (HEQS) will function best in OTTD using the engine pool: that will enable the full extended range of vehicles, including some that are frankly a bit bonkers, and one or two that will radically change the gameplay possibilities of RVs. I kid you not :)

My understanding is that the engine pool opens up many more IDs, however I believe conflicts might be possible between sets even when the engine pool is in use. Engine pool is the most likely route to use LV4 with HEQS.

A basic version of HEQS will be available for TTDPatch players and OpenTTD players who can't use engine pool. This will offer a small range of key vehicles such as mining trucks and wheeled tractors. It is intended to be used alongside GRVTS, or possibly the default vehicles. I can't say whether this version will be compatible with LV4, but I imagine there will be ID conflicts.

HEQS running costs, speed, capacity etc will be balanced for gameplay against GRVTS, not any other set.

Specifications
* Prime Mover - 10.36 metres long, 3.35m wide, 5.49m high
* Weight - 45 tonnes payload 10 tonnes
* Turning Circle - 61 metres
* Trailers(2) - 9m long, 3m wide, 2.13m high
* Payload - 35 tonnes each

Mechanical Details
* Power Unit 44.74 kw (60 hp) Blackstone water cooled single cylinder crude oil engine.
* Bore, 228 mm, Stroke, 450 mm, 215 RPM.
* Single flywheel, 2.13 m diameter, Weight 3 tonnes.
* Gear Box 3.15m long, 1.37m deep, 0.91m wide.
* Oil Capacity 430 Litres.
* 4 forward speeds 3.2, 2.4, 1.6, 0.8 km/h.
* 2 reverse speeds 0.8, and 0.4 km/h.
* Crude Oil 19,800 litres.
* General purpose water 3,400 lts.
* Drinking water 1,000 lts.

from Red Cliffs & District Historical Society Inc.
